Interbike attendees will have plenty of opportunity to immerse themselves in the world of triathlon thanks to special VIP access to the Ironman World Championship 70.3 the day before Interbike begins and an expansive Tri Zone at the Interbike expo itself.
A new 2011 partnership with Ironman gives attendees a chance to see the Ironman 70.3 event on Sunday 10 September in nearby Henderson, Nevada. Interbike visitors will be able to access a special viewing area at the bike-to-run transition, with a TV screen broadcasting live coverage from the course.

At the Interbike International Bicycle Expo, the Tri Zone will feature triathlon-specific products, panels and educational seminars – including sessions on the specifics of fit and geometry related to tri bikes by Dan Empfield of slowtwitch.com — in the Tri Learning Center, a 50-seat presentation area in the zone.
Presented in partnership with LAVA Magazine and industry association Triathlon America, the Tri Zone at Interbike will function as a gathering place and information centre for one of the fastest growing sports in America and a booming corner of the cycling industry.

The Tri Zone is located adjacent to the Health+Fitness Business Expo on the street-level floor in the Sands Expo Center.
The Interbike OutDoor Demo begins the day after the Ironman World Championship 70.3 in Bootleg Canyon, running from 12-13 September. The Interbike International Bicycle Expo follows from 14-16 September at the Sands.
Now in its 30th year, Interbike is the largest cycling expo in North America, with 1,100 cycling-related exhibiting brands and close to 12,000 retailer buyers expected to attend.
